AI Summary

This resolution honors the life and legacy of Thomas Dinkler, a distinguished citizen from Croton-on-Hudson, New York, who passed away on May 19, 2025, at the age of 79. Born in Lackawanna, New York, Dinkler was known as "Tex" to his friends and family, and had a notable career at Con Edison as a computer repair technician, where he worked for 35 years before retiring in 2000. He was deeply involved in his community, serving as Chief of the Croton-on-Hudson Fire Department from 1996-2001 and being an active member of the American Legion. Dinkler was married to his wife Audrey for 49 years and had two sons, Philip and Russell, and four grandchildren. The resolution highlights his commitment to public service, his professional contributions, and his humanitarian spirit, recognizing him as a devoted community member who made significant contributions to local civic life. The legislative body resolves to pause in its deliberations to mourn his passing and transmit a copy of the resolution to his family as a tribute to his life and service.
